Amy Elizabeth Richter is an Episcopal priest. She has served as rector of St. Anne's Church in Annapolis, Maryland since 2009.

Richter received a Ph.D. in New Testament Theology from Marquette University. She holds an M.Div. from Princeton Theological Seminary, an M.T.S. from Harvard Divinity School, a B.A. from Valparaiso University, and a Diploma in Anglican Studies from the General Theological Seminary of the Episcopal Church. She previously served as Missioner for Lifelong Christian Formation for the Diocese of Maryland, the rector of St. Paul's Episcopal Church, Milwaukee, the associate rector of St. Chrysostom’s Episcopal Church in Chicago, and as assistant minister of Church of the Advent, Kennett Square, Pennsylvania.

Richter has authored or co-authored three books.

Richter was featured in a New York Times article about competing in a bodybuilding competition.
